Overview
The Guatemala sticker visa, which is issued as a physical label in the applicant's passport, permits travel, business, or brief visits to Guatemala. At the embassy or consulate, applicants must present the necessary paperwork, a current passport, a travel schedule, and proof of funds. The Guatemalan immigration authorities' approval determines the validity of the visa and the length of the stay.

Eligibility
• Valid Passport: The passport must have blank pages and be valid for at least six months after the date of travel. • Completed Visa Application Form: The visa application needs to be correctly completed and signed. • Passport-size photos: Current images required by the embassy. • Traveling for a specific purpose, such as tourism, business, or visiting loved ones, is known as the purpose of travel. • Travel Schedule: Verified flight information and proof of lodging. • Bank statements or other evidence of the money needed to pay for the trip serve as financial proof. • Supporting Documents: If necessary, an invitation letter, an employment letter, or business documentation.
Important Notes
• The Guatemalan government issues the sticker visa as a tangible document that is stamped on a passport. • To prevent delays or rejection, applicants must make sure all documents are accurate and complete. • A passport with blank pages must be valid for at least six months prior to the departure date. • The Guatemalan Embassy or Consulate has the final say over the processing time and approval of visas. • Applications should be submitted well in advance of the intended travel date.
Rejection Reasons
• Incomplete or Inaccurate Documents: The visa application form may contain inaccuracies or missing documents. • Inadequate Financial Proof: Not providing enough money to cover the trip. • Uncertain Travel Goals: Inadequate or ambiguous travel schedules or plans. • A passport that does not match the requirements for validity (typically six months) is considered invalid or damaged. • False or Misleading Information: Giving false documents or inaccurate information. • Weak Ties to Home Country: After a visit, there aren't enough compelling reasons to go back. • Previous Immigration Violations: Overstays of visas or immigration problems in other nations.
FAQs
1.Can I travel to Honduras, El Salvador, and Nicaragua with a Guatemala visa?
Yes, under the CA-4 Agreement, your visa or entry stamp allows travel between all four countries without additional visas for up to 90 days total.
2.Do I need a visa to transit through Guatemala?
If you're staying inside the airport and your layover is short, you may not need a visa. However, if you leave the airport, visa rules for your nationality apply.
